Event warmup:

got in the water and swam to the first buoy and back - chilly - about 68 degrees (a little cooler and choppier than last year)
Swim
  • 15m 24s
  • 880 yards
  • 01m 45s / 100 yards
Comments:

Much choppier than last year - one of the "3-mile" swimmers called it "treacherous." Horrible that they started all the women in one wave - all 94 of us! Way too many people. Waves ahead of us were pushed off course due to the current, and we found ourselves swimming into people as they were making their way back (they had crossed over the buoys and were head-on into us!) Amazingly, I just kept going - recovering from laryngitis, kept it nice and slow and had a decent time out of the water.

Comments:

What was up with the rusty water? Uuuughhh...at the turnaround, the water in the cup was brown, which should have told me something. They must have gotten it from a rusty spicket.
Post race
Event comments:

Really love this little race - 2nd year, and it has gotten bigger. I don't think the volunteers expected as many last minute sign ups (I know I was one). As a result, the waves were probably bigger than intended - 94 women in at once was way too much. Some of the water stations were a little crowded, and the water was either warm or rusty!!!

Way better "bling" this year. Instead of tinny medal for age groupers (last year), really nice plaque this time. Everyone also got a nice "finisher's" medal, which doubled as a bottle opener. And the T-shirts were WAY better! Beautifully designed "sports" T (whatever that material is) instead of last year's cotton, which shrunk and I can't wear it.

Nice addition of having a coffee vendor present since there wasn't a place to stop and eat within 12 miles of the race site.

Overall, still one of my favorite races - as it grows, I'm sure the organizers will adjust in the future.
